For the first time in provincial history, Ontario retailers can now legally open for business on Victoria Day Monday. This operational shift follows recent amendments passed by the Ford government to the Retail Business Holidays Act, granting stores the flexibility to open on both Family Day and Victoria Day. However, the province insists that employee scheduling remains voluntary. Good idea or bad idea? Would you take advantage of it?
